Try this Christmas Biscotti with Cranberries and Pistachios recipe, or contribute your own.

2. Line two baking sheets with parchment paper or silpats
3. Sift the flour, baking powder and salt in a bowl
4. Using an electric mixer, beat butter and sugar to blend well. Beat in eggs, 1 at a time. Mix in lemon peel, vanilla, and aniseed.
5. Blend in the flour mixture until just blended.
6. Stir in cranberries and pistachios (dough will be sticky)
7. Turn the dough out onto a floured surface. Gather the dough together and kneed a few times. Divide in half. Roll each half into a long log about 2 1/2 inches wide.
8. Transfer the logs to the baking sheets.
9. Bake logs until almost firm to touch but still pale, about 28 minutes. Cool logs on the baking sheets 10 minutes.
10. Carefully transfer the logs to a cutting board. Using serrated knife and a gentle sawing motion, cut logs crosswise into generous 1/2 thick slices.
11. Place slices cut side down on the baking sheets.
12. Bake until firm and pale golden, about 9 minutes. Turn slices over and bake for another 9 minutes. Turn oven off. Turn slices upright and return to the oven until firm, about 15 minutes
13. OPTIONAL: Melt chocolate in a double boiler until smooth. Dip one end of each cookie into the chocolate. Place cookies on cooled baking sheet until chocolate is firm, about 30 minutes.
